What is the Lifespan of a Carbon Fiber Hockey Ice Stick?

Dec 25, 2024

Leave a message

The lifespan of a carbon fiber hockey ice stick typically ranges from 1 to 3 seasons, depending on various factors such as usage frequency, player style, and maintenance. These high-performance sticks, known for being lightweight and durable, can last anywhere from 50 to 150 games or practice sessions. Professional players who use their sticks intensively may need replacements more frequently, while recreational players might enjoy a longer lifespan from their carbon fiber ice hockey sticks. The advanced materials and construction techniques used in these sticks contribute to their longevity, allowing players to enhance shooting power and maintain consistent performance over an extended period compared to traditional wooden sticks.

Factors Affecting the Lifespan of Carbon Fiber Hockey Ice Sticks

Usage Intensity and Frequency

The lifespan of a carbon fiber ice hockey stick is significantly influenced by how often and intensely it's used. Professional players who engage in daily practices and frequent games may find their sticks wearing out faster than recreational players who use them less frequently. The high-impact nature of slap shots, face-offs, and defensive plays can gradually weaken the stick's structure over time.

Player Position and Style

Different playing positions and styles can affect the longevity of a carbon fiber hockey ice stick. Defensemen, who often use their sticks for powerful slap shots and blocking, may experience faster wear compared to forwards who might focus more on wrist shots and puck handling. Additionally, players with a more aggressive style, frequently engaging in battles along the boards or taking numerous high-impact shots, may find their sticks deteriorating more quickly.

Maintenance and Care

Proper maintenance plays a crucial role in extending the lifespan of a carbon fiber ice hockey stick. Regular inspection for cracks or damage, storing the stick in a controlled environment away from extreme temperatures, and avoiding unnecessary impacts can significantly prolong its life. Players who take meticulous care of their equipment often enjoy a longer-lasting stick, maximizing the benefits of its lightweight and durable construction.

Advantages of Carbon Fiber Hockey Ice Sticks

Superior Strength-to-Weight Ratio

Carbon fiber ice hockey sticks boast an impressive strength-to-weight ratio, making them a popular choice among players of all levels. This unique property allows manufacturers to create sticks that are incredibly lightweight without compromising on durability. The reduced weight enables players to maneuver the stick more swiftly, leading to improved puck control and quicker shot releases. Despite their light feel, these sticks can withstand the rigors of intense gameplay, contributing to their extended lifespan compared to traditional materials.

Enhanced Performance Characteristics

One of the key advantages of carbon fiber hockey ice sticks is their ability to enhance shooting power. The material's properties allow for efficient energy transfer from the player's motion to the puck, resulting in harder and more accurate shots. The stiffness of carbon fiber also contributes to improved feel and responsiveness, allowing players to better sense the puck on their stick. These performance enhancements not only improve a player's game but also contribute to the stick's longevity by reducing the need for excessive force in shots and passes.

Consistency Throughout Lifespan

Unlike wooden sticks that may warp or change properties over time, carbon fiber ice hockey sticks maintain their performance characteristics throughout their lifespan. This consistency allows players to rely on the same feel and performance from their stick game after game, season after season. The material's resistance to environmental factors such as humidity and temperature changes further contributes to its stable performance over time, making it a reliable choice for players seeking consistency in their equipment.

Maximizing the Lifespan of Your Carbon Fiber Hockey Ice Stick

Proper Storage Techniques

To maximize the lifespan of your carbon fiber ice hockey stick, proper storage is essential. Store your stick in a cool, dry place away from direct sunlight and extreme temperatures. Avoid leaning heavy objects against it or storing it in a position that puts unnecessary stress on the shaft or blade. Using a stick bag can provide additional protection during transport and storage, shielding it from potential impacts and environmental factors that could compromise its structural integrity.

Regular Inspection and Maintenance

Regularly inspecting your carbon fiber ice hockey stick for signs of wear or damage can help you address issues before they lead to catastrophic failure. Check for small cracks, especially in high-stress areas like the hosel (where the blade meets the shaft) and along the shaft itself. If you notice any damage, consider using appropriate repair products designed for carbon fiber, or consult with a professional about potential repairs. Keeping the blade and shaft clean and free from debris can also prevent unnecessary wear and maintain the stick's performance characteristics.

Adapting Usage to Extend Longevity

While the lightweight and durable nature of carbon fiber ice hockey sticks allows for enhanced shooting power, being mindful of how you use your stick can significantly extend its lifespan. Avoid using your game stick for off-ice training or casual play, as these activities can cause unnecessary wear. When blocking shots, try to use the shaft rather than the blade to preserve the stick's integrity. By reserving your high-performance carbon fiber stick for on-ice gameplay and practices, you can ensure it remains in optimal condition for when it matters most, maximizing both its lifespan and your investment.
